(4) Setting of the number of decimals

It is possible to set the number of decimals. Make the setting as necessary. The setting range is

0 to 7.

Figure 2.4.13 Information Control Table 2

When you make the setting, a window for selecting processing when changing the number of

decimals appears; you should select whether to convert only the displayed number of digits or to

convert data according to the changed number of digits.

Figure 2.4.14 Selection of Processing at Changing the Number of Decimals

* When you convert the displayed number of decimals only, a conversion error occurs if there

is any data whose maximum number of digits exceeds 8. The corresponding data is

displayed in the error message. You must modify the corresponding area and convert again.
